media wall
hi
how do i get sky remote to control tv if sky q box is hid behind tv on media wall?

Re: media wall
There will be a few times when your remote must have line of sight of the box - initially & then if things get reset.
Otherwise once paired SKY Q Remotes use bluetooth which do not need line of sight - my SKY Q box is on a shelf behind my TV and works very well (in fact I have used the remote from my rear garden with the box in my front lounge)
We must, however, caution placing a SKY Q box where it might not have sufficient ventilation & the main box in particular should be horizontal not vertical as the Hard disc & other components use the top of the box to release the heat generated

All touch remotes are bluetooth capable - in fact the touch feature requires bluetooth just like voice control does- I have had all versions
The only 'infrared only' versions are old mini remotes that did not have a voice button (or touch pad of course)

You should be able to pair any non infrared only remote - but note only one remote can be paired with the box itself - only the last one paired remains paired & can be used for voice control
